Roehl's Koepel receives trucking industry's top HR honor

MARSHFIELD, Wisc. - Wisconsin-based Roehl Transport - which has a terminal in Carnesville - was recently recognized by the American Trucking Association (ATA) when it singled out its Vice President of Workforce Development and Administration as the trucking industry's Human Resources Professional of the Year.

In picking up the award , Greg Koepel, credited the company's 2,200 employees with the corporate culture and successes that brought him the recognition.

"The fact is the Roehl family, leadership team and staff are committed to the concept of driver success and are very open to innovative policies for ensuring it. Roehl drivers, in turn, embrace the values underlying our human resources practices as true professionals earning national recognition for safety and customer service," Koepel said. "Roehl is very much a team organization. Our successes in every aspect of the business reflect the efforts and commitment of the entire company," he added.

Koepel is the first person to receive the award from the ATA, which intends to continue recognizing the human resources function within the industry by making it an annual honor.

In addition to Koepel's award, Roehl's flatbed division was honored as the second safest in the nation among small fleets while the company's van division safety record was the third best in the nation among large carriers. In addition Roehl received the ATA's Excellence in Claims/Loss Prevention Award.

Roehl is one of the 100 largest trucking companies in the nation, providing truckload van, curtainside and flatbed services throughout the U.S. and Canada.
